Esposas (en. Handcuffs)

/esˈpo.sas/

Meaning & Definition

EnglishSpanish
noun
Device used by security agencies to restrict movement of hands.
The police officer put the handcuffs on the suspect.
El policía le puso las esposas al sospechoso.
Colloquial term for referring to marriage or a committed relationship.
They say that marriage is the handcuffs of love.
Dicen que el matrimonio son las esposas del amor.

Etymology

From Latin 'sponsae', meaning 'betrothed' or 'married'.
